A painter, educator, and Southern California art world fixture since the 1950s, Roland Reiss suddenly turned to sculpture in the 1960s, creating miniature versions of domestic spaces encased within Plexiglas that he called tableaus. Guest-curated by Kate Johnson, Personal Politics focuses on these miniature scenes, each containing psychological references and occasionally reflecting influences from Hollywood and the film industry.
